Abstract
pp interactions at 11 momenta in the range 0.9 to 2.0 GeV/c have been studied. The elastic angular distributions, covering the c.m. angular range 22°-90°, agree in general with Hoshizaki's phase-shift analysis which shows the looping 1Din and 3F3 amplitudes in the Argand diagram. About 80% of pnπ+ events come from the nΔ++ state at all momenta above 1.2 GeV/c. The behavior of the density matrix elements of the Δ++ show no momentum or angular dependence. A large fraction of ppπ0 events also come from the pΔ+ state at all momenta above 1.2 GeV/c. The behavior of the Δ+ density matrix elements is similar to that for the case of Δ++.
